[ARCHIVED] LeeTran to provide extended New Year’s Eve services for Fort Myers Beach!

LeeTranLogo-1100x619

LeeTran will provide extended transportation services on Fort Myers Beach to accommodate New Year’s Eve festivities. 

Fort Myers Beach Service will include:

  • The free open-air beach trams will extend service until 1 a.m. from Bowditch Point Park to the beach library.
  • Route 490, which travels between Times Square and the Beach Park & Ride at 11101 Summerlin Square Drive, will run its normal service until the last departure off the beach around 10:30 p.m. After this final departure from Times Square, a shuttle service will start from the Main Street Park & Ride (at the foot of the Matanzas Pass Bridge) to the Beach Park & Ride until 1 a.m. Jan 1, following the fireworks festivities. 

Riders seeking transportation from Fort Myers Beach to the Beach Park & Ride after the bridge closure will have to walk across the bridge to the Main Street Park & Ride to catch the 490 shuttle to the Beach Park & Ride. The last shuttle to the Beach Park & Ride will depart the Main Street Park & Ride at 1 a.m.
